O Lord, my God, in you I take refuge…  Psalm 7:2

Lord, I am under attack.  Each day I am tempted by the world, the flesh and the devil to sin.  Each day my belief in you is challenged by the ways of mankind.  The popular culture tries to pull me away from you and the truth of your word.  False idols of pleasure, riches, comfort and tolerance of evil are placed before me.  Lord, I come to you and seek the safety that only you can provide.  Protect me and my family from the assaults of the evil one.  Save me from my own weaknesses.  Give me refuge from the world’s values and deceptions.  Lord, I cannot stay faithful to you on my own.  I must rely on your grace.  I trust that you are my refuge and my strength.  I believe that your mother Mary and all the saints are my allies and cheerleaders urging me on to victory.  Lord, I need your help with one particular temptation today.  I lay it at the foot of your cross.  Remove this darkness from my heart and so I can experience the joy of union with you.  Amen.
